Officials: Dog found chained to cinderblock in West Islip canal
A Rottweiler mix was found dead in a canal in West Islip Thursday morning, prompting an investigation by police and the SPCA.
When officials from the Town of Islip Animal Shelter and the Suffolk SPCA arrived on the scene, they say the dog was chained to a cinderblock and possibly drowned alive.
Officials want to know if the dog was dead or alive when it was tossed into the canal. If the necrospy shows the dog was alive at the time, whoever is responsible could face felony charges.
SPCA Chief Roy Gross says the Rottweiler mix was tan and black and about 7 years old.
Anyone with information about the dog is urged to call the Suffolk SPCA at 631-382-7722. All calls are kept confidential.
